So I noticed my truck had a bit of a lean... it is an old truck so I didn't think too much of it. Anyways it started to bother me after a couple of days so I decided to take a look under and see what's up.

My rear sway bar end link top bolt / cage nut are missing! Probably from some spirited driving combined with the age of the vehicle.

Can someone point me in the right direction to replacing these parts? The bolt never comes with new end links and the nut is a whole other issue. Rock auto has nothing

End links wont cause the lean. If it is leaning to the left. It is because the gas tank is on the left.
You can compensate it. Lift the front off the ground and adjust the torsion bar. Srcew it in to raise, loosen to lower.
